Coding 2021-12-31

By Max Woerner Chase

Okay, I've managed to squeeze all the enjoyment that I can get out of rewriting this Dynamic code, which I'm sure is more enjoyment than most people could get. It's not totally the way I'd like it, but it's close enough. Let's see what I need to do next:

At this point, the typing errors should force everything into using the last abstraction, and I can make sure the ergonomics look reasonable, and then finally write some tests for this stuff.

At the moment, I need to take some time to cool off.

Good night.